Kitchen Tour: Poised and Polished

Missouri kitchen remodel

A St. Louis home gets a glam kitchen makeover with some splurges but also budget-conscious choices.

Refined remodel

Missouri kitchen remodel

With a new footprint of 15x16 feet, this Missouri kitchen was a giant step up from the home's original 10x10 foot space. The homeowners worked with a design team to create a kitchen that had the upscale feel they wanted without the high cost of a complete custom makeover.

Custom details

Missouri kitchen remodel

The homeowners initially wanted custom cabinets but opted to save thousands of dollars by purchasing stock ones instead. Custom details such as moldings, corbels and legs added style without sticker shock.

Handy for hosting

Kitchen island

An undercounter microwave and icemaker in the island are handy for entertaining and easily accessible from the breakfast room and nearby family room. A cabinet-depth refrigerator on the wall behind the island imitates a built-in but costs much less.
